28. Deputy Jackie Cahill asked the Minister for Enterprise, Trade and Employment what additional funding is being provided in 2024 to the IDA regional property programme development;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[51400/23]

View answer

Written answers

As part of my Department's Estimates negotiations, I secured an increase of €5m of Exchequer Funding on 2023 levels of €60m in capital spending for the IDA in respect of the agency’s property programme. The IDA Regional Property Programme ensures the supply of land, buildings and infrastructure in regional locations as required by current and prospective clients of the IDA itself as well as Enterprise Ireland and the LEOs.

Over the lifetime of IDA’s current strategy, IDA Ireland will progress the delivery of 19 specific Advanced Building Solutions (ABS) in 15 regional locations, chosen after extensive analysis, engagement, review, and consultation as well as macroeconomic considerations, existing clusters, and available resources.

Success to date, in line with IDA’s Build programme, has seen the investment or expected investment of companies across the current property footprint. To build on this positive momentum and ensure IDA has the ability to compete for investments of scale across all activities and sectors, it is imperative that the Agency can be agile in developing and maintaining a property portfolio to support future investments across all regions as they arise.

In this context, continued investment in infrastructure upgrades, provision and future proofing, in addition to further land acquisitions and the building of new buildings is critical to delivering on IDA’s and Enterprise Ireland’s balanced regional development agenda with the proposed expenditure being commensurate with this ambitious strategy.
